Standard Wallboard is a cost effective standard plasterboard for standard drylining performance.
This plasterboard can be used in a single layer for most wall and ceiling applications where minimal levels of fire, structural and acoustic performance are specified, or in multiple layers for higher performance. It is made of a gypsum core between paper liners, face being a ivory/white colour and the reverse being brown.
Please note this product is NOT suitable for moist or wet condition and should not be used where temperatures exceed 52ºC

CUTTING
Can be cut with a plasterboard saw, or score the front face paper with a sharp knife, snap it over a straightedge, then cut the back face paper. Cut holes for things like socket boxes using a utility saw.
FIXING
Fix the board with the decorative side facing outwards to receive finishes. Install fixings at least 13mm from cut edges and 10mm from bound edges. Position cut edges at internal angles wherever possible. Stagger horizontal and vertical joints between layers by at least 600mm

SNAGGING & REPAIRING MINOR DAMAGES
For minor damage and dents, check that the board core isn't shattered. If it's intact, fill the damaged area with Gyproc EasiFill 60, allow it to set, then apply a second coat if you need to. When it's dry, sand it to a finish before redecorating the area. For a damaged core, broken edges or extensive damage, repair and replacement procedures differ depending on the number of board layers and fire resistance of the system; please contact Technical Support Team for specific advice.
